Understanding Research Chemicals: What You Need to Know
Research substances are quite new synthetic compounds that are often created in laboratories. They are usually designed to mimic the effects of known illicit substances like copyright, copyright, or hallucinogens, but with modified molecular formulas. The word "research chemicals" implies they are designed for scientific research, however, they are sometimes abused recreationally, leading to substantial health hazards and legal repercussions. Due to the rapid pace of development, regulations are frequently incomplete, making their availability difficult to manage and posing a large threat to public well-being.

The Legal Grey Area of Research Chemicals
The landscape surrounding research substances exists within a complex judicial murky space. Often marketed as "not for human ingestion," these substances frequently appear shortly after existing regulations are passed, exploiting loopholes and shifting understandings to avoid outright banning. Manufacturers and vendors can operate in this vacuum by claiming the items are intended solely for academic analysis or forensic investigation, creating a challenging situation for agencies attempting to control their distribution. This ongoing “cat and game” between legislation and innovation results in a constantly evolving legal status, leaving consumers and law enforcement alike in a state of uncertainty. Ultimately, the future of these chemicals copyrights on the ability of legislatures to adapt and here address the ingenuity employed in circumventing current restrictions, presenting a continuing challenge for both public safety and fairness.

Novel Substances and the Neural System: Examining the Consequences
The growing use of novel psychoactive substances presents a serious challenge to safety. These compounds, often produced to avoid legal restrictions, have scarce research regarding their exact effects on the mind. Initial observations suggest a range of potential adverse effects, including alteration of neurotransmitter networks. These can manifest as modified moods, false perceptions, anxiety, suspiciousness, and in extreme cases, fits or irreversible brain damage.
